Tasks
Full text debug for 1st, 2nd and 3rd party products
Checking localised user support materials
Capturing screenshots and video footage
Conducting connectivity and monitor tests
Accomplishing project related duties assigned by superiors and meeting deadlines
Requirements
Italian at a native speaker’s level (including extensive knowledge of grammar, punctuation and orthographical rules in the target language)
Understanding of Italian culture
Very good command of English
Passion and interest to play video games along with advanced gaming skills and understanding how games work would be very beneficial
Ability to explain things logically in writing
Pro-active and flexible approach to work
Good knowledge of PC/Windows/Microsoft 365
Teamwork-oriented mindset and ability to work effectively under pressure

Nintendo's mission is to put smiles on the faces of everyone we touch. We do so by creating new surprises for people across the world to enjoy together. We've forged our own path since 1889, when we began making hanafuda playing cards in Kyoto, Japan. Today, we’re fortunate to be able to share our characters, ideas and worlds through the medium of video games and the entertainment industry.
Nintendo of America, established in 1980 and based in Redmond, Washington, is a wholly owned subsidiary of Nintendo Co., Ltd. We are committed to delivering best-in-class products and services to our customers and to investing in the well-being of our employees as part of the global Nintendo family.
